2024-25 (Gr.):
 Started all 32 games for the Islanders in her final season with the team...Averaged 10.6 points, 4.0 rebounds, 1.3 steals and a team-leading 3.1 assists in 28.8 minutes per game...Named to the Southland Conference All-Academic Second-Team for the second consecutive year after the season...Earned Southland Conference Player of the Week honors following standout performances at the UTRGV Holiday Classic, with wins over Kansas City and Eastern Michigan, capped by a dominant home win over Schreiner. Averaged 15 points, 4.3 rebounds, 3.3 assists and 2.3 steals per game over this stretch...Ranked in the top 20 in the conference in points (19th), assists (T9th), steals (T18th) and minutes (19th) per game...Scored a career-high 22 points against Eastern Michigan for the team’s highest single-game scoring performance of the year... Posted double figures in 20 of 32 games played... Recorded five or more assists in eight games...Finishes her career ranked eighth in program history in career steals (149) and ninth in career assists (242).

2023-24 (Sr.):  Earned a Dave Campbell's All-Texas Honorable Mention following a breakout senior season... helped the Islanders win the SLC Tournament and advance to the NCAA Tournament for the first time in program history... scored 15 points after going 6-of-8 from the field against No. 1 USC in the NCAA First Round... named to the All-Conference Second Team after ending the season as the team's leading scorer in SLC play with 13.3 ppg... finished second in the league in steals with 44, third in field goal percentage (52.0), fourth in assists with 3.4 apg and fourth in assist:turnover ratio at 1.5... broke the program record for assists in a single game with 12 against A&M-Commerce... recorded her career-first double-double of 11 points and 10 rebounds against UIW... led the team with a .511 field-goal percentage... scored in double figures in both the SLC semifinal and championship match...  poured in her career-high 22 points against Lamar... scored in double figures 21 times... ended the year on a seven-game streak of scoring in double figures

2022-23 (Jr.): Played in 30 of the 31 games with four starts, including in the WNIT... totaled 122 points and 59 rebounds on the year to average 4.1 points and 2.0 rebounds per game... season-high 12 points at New Orleans... pulled down career-high six rebounds twice in wins over McNeese and St. Thomas (TX)... recorded a block against UTRGV and Southeastern... grabbed a pair of steals three times... helped the Islanders to a regular season championship and postseason appearance in the WNIT

2021-22 (So.): Totaled 67 points and 52 rebounds on the year and averaged 3.0 points and 2.4 rebounds per game… missed time due to injury but played in 19 games… season-high eight points in home wins against Northwestern State and Nicholls… pulled down five rebounds three times… started and logged a career-high 32:28 minutes against UIW where she submitted six points and five rebounds… helped the team post its first undefeated home season in program history with a 14-0 mark

2020-21 (Fr.): One of two student-athletes to play in all 19 games... made starts against UTRGV and St. Edward's... totaled 68 points, 20 rebounds, 16 steals and 13 assists on the year... registered a career-high 14 points on six-of-seven shooting against New Orleans... made at least a pair of field goals in eight games

Prior to Texas A&M-Corpus Christi: Played for the Catalan national team, earning numerous honors including; U18's top defender, top scorer and four-time player of the week..named MVP of the U16 Lloret International Tournament...averaged 16 points, six rebounds and three assists/per game during the 2019-20 season
